2. How does pachinko differ from other forms of gambling?

While pachinko shares similarities with gambling, it is not considered gambling itself. In pachinko, players receive balls for their efforts, which they can exchange for prizes. However, the exchange rate is often low, leading players to play for longer periods of time in the hopes of winning more balls.

3. Why is pachinko so popular in Japan?

Pachinkos popularity can be attributed to several factors. First, it serves as a social activity, as many players go to pachinko parlors with friends or family. Second, pachinko offers a sense of excitement and anticipation, as players never know when they will win a ball. Lastly, pachinko has become a symbol of perseverance, as players often return to the game after a loss, hoping to turn their luck around.
